The 2023 Governorship Election Results from LGAs across Nigeria have started trickling in.

Touchaheart reports that on Saturday, March 18, 2023, elections for governor and state houses of assembly were conducted throughout the nation of Nigeria in West Africa. A total of 28 States held governorship elections across the country, with only a few of the current governors running for re-election. The majority of the States will be choosing new chief executive officers.

This online news source is aware that there are thousands of candidates vying for 993 seats in the State House of Assembly in addition to the 2023 governorship race. The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C), Nigeria’s electoral supervisor, provided the figures that support this information.

The 28 states where governorship elections were held on March 18, 2023, in alphabetical order, are Abia, Adamawa, Akwa Ibom, Bauchi, Benue, Borno, Cross River, Delta, Ebonyi, Enugu, Gombe, Jigawa, Kaduna, Kano, Katsina, Kebbi, Kwara, Lagos, Nasarawa, Niger, Ogun, Oyo, Plateau, Rivers, Sokoto, Taraba, Yobe, Zamfara.

Touchaheart Nigeria reports that the electoral umpire deployed the Bimodal Voter Accreditation System and its Result Viewing Portal (IReV) for Nigeria Election 2023. The BVAS and IReV are new technologies introduced by the electoral body for the accreditation and electronic transmission of votes for this year’s polls.

PDP ahead, as collation begins in Delta
COLLATION of results in Saturday’s governorship election has begun in the headquarters of the Independent National Electoral Commission, INEC, Asaba, the Delta State capital.

The collation began at 9 a.m., this morning with the announcement of results from Aniocha North, where the PDP candidate, Sheriff Oborevwori, polled 8,938 votes and APC candidate, Senator Ovie Omo-Agege, scored 4,386.

According to the results announced by the State Collation Officer, Prof. Georgewill Owuneri, the Labour Party candidate, Ken Pela, came a distant third with 1,883 votes.

In Ika North-East, Oborevwori scored 26,760 to come first, while Senator Ovie Omo-Agege got APC 4,733 votes.

In Ndokwa East, Oborevwori got 10,146 votes; Omo-Agege, 9,044, and Pela, 251.

Makinde wins 15 LGs so far
The governorship candidate of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) in Oyo State, Seyi Makinde, has won in 15 out of the 16 local governments announced so far by the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C).

The announcement of the governorship result is currently ongoing at Mutiu Agboke Collation Centre, Oyo INEC headquarters, Agodi, Ibadan.

Makinde, who is the incumbent governor of the state, is seeking re-election.
